The teachers of the Oguz Khan University are undergoing internship in Japan
From October 1 to October 17, two teachers of the Oguz Khan University of Engineering and Technology of Turkmenistan are undergoing an internship at the Nanomedicine Innovation Center (ICONM) of Japan. This trip was organized in accordance with the Memorandum of Understanding signed between the Oguz Khan University of Engineering and Technology of Turkmenistan and The Innovation Center of Nanomedicine at the Kawasaki Institute of Industrial Development (Japan). The National Pavilion of Turkmenistan at EXPO-2025 in Osaka welcomed the two millionth visitor
At the World Expo 2025, held in Osaka, Japan, the National Pavilion of Turkmenistan celebrated a significant milestone: its visitor traffic exceeded two million people. The anniversary guest was registered at the end of September, which was a clear confirmation of the high international interest in the country. ADB invests $75 million to build a new nursing school in Ashgabat
The Asian Development Bank (ADB) has approved a $75 million loan and a $2 million grant from the Japan Fund for Prosperous and Resilient Asia and the Pacific (JFPR) to implement a project on the development of nursing and midwifery in Turkmenistan, according to the bank’s press release. This is the first ADB project in the country’s healthcare sector, aimed at strengthening the nursing profession and expanding public access to quality medical services.
